Angie4m wrote:You say it's hesitant, I assume you've been sat with in traffic with the car in neutral and the park brake on? If so it's the hill assist your feeling. It holds the car for a few seconds only thing is you want to move right then. It can't differentiate between a hill and not a hill so everytime you release the parking brake the hill start assist kicks in.

You'll get used to it and adapt it for that. Maybe letting off a second or so early to move off right when you want.

As for the gears, as you've said you'll get used to it, however the power is there if you need it, the car kicks down really well changes to suit. If you do find you want that extra power with a bit more bite and want to be assured of it then stick it in sports and you'll have a blast. I find the kick down very quick and a not really hesitant like others I've driven
